Kesar Murgh Fry is a delicious Indian dish known for its rich aroma and vibrant flavors. Originating from North India, this dish combines succulent pieces of chicken with the warm, earthy flavors of black pepper and the luxurious touch of saffron, known as ‘kesar’. The delicate balance of spices, including cumin and coriander, creates a tantalizing taste profile that is both spicy and aromatic. The addition of saffron not only lends a beautiful golden hue but also imparts a subtle sweetness that complements the heat of the pepper. This dish is a favorite among spice lovers and is often served with naan or rice, making it a perfect choice for family dinners or special occasions.

Directions

Step 1

Soak the saffron in 2 Tbsp of warm milk and set aside.

Step 2

Heat oil in a pan and sauté onions until golden brown.

Step 3

Add ginger and garlic and cook until fragrant.

Step 4

Add chopped tomatoes and cook until they soften.

Step 5

Add chicken pieces and stir well.

Step 6

Cook for 10 minutes until chicken starts to brown.

Step 7

Add cumin, coriander, black pepper, and salt. Mix well.

Step 8

Pour in the saffron milk,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es until chicken is tender.

Step 9

Remove from heat and garnish with fresh coriander leaves before serving.
